John Wall out two months with patella injury

by:Mrs. Tyler Thompson09/28/12

@MrsTylerKSR

It's been a rough Friday for John Wall. The Wizards just announced that Wall will be out for eight weeks due to a stress fracture in his patella (knee cap). The good news? Doctors caught it early, so he won't have to undergo surgery. If his recovery goes according to plan, he could return around Thanksgiving. In a statement released by the team, Wall vowed to be back on the court as soon as possible:
“My teammates and I are all excited to build on the improvement we made at the end of last season, and I know they will continue to make great progress while I get through this setback. I will work extremely hard to make sure I get back as soon as possible so I can re-join them and help our team continue to improve.”
